Soft Protectors: Basic Protection from Dust and Scratches
Soft protectors, or pop shields, are clear PET plastic cases designed to fit snugly around Funko POP! boxes. They shield your collectibles from dust, fingerprints, moisture, and minor scratches, keeping them in pristine condition. Thanks to their lightweight design, they don't add much pressure to the cardboard, though they can collapse under heavy stacking.
"A soft Funko Pop protector is essential to protect your figures from dust and sun damage." – Pop And Figures
Most soft protectors come with a locking tab mechanism to keep the lid securely closed, ensuring your box stays safe. These protectors are available in thicknesses ranging from 0.35 mm to 0.75 mm, with thicker options offering better durability. When stored in a soft protector and placed against a wall, it's safe to stack up to 10 Funko POP! boxes high.
How to Pick the Right Soft Protector
When selecting a soft protector, prioritize crystal-clear, scratch-free PET plastic for an unobstructed view of your figure. Thickness matters too - 0.50 mm is great for regular use, while 0.35 mm works for lighter handling. It's crucial to choose a protector that matches your box dimensions perfectly, whether it's a standard 4-inch, 6-inch, 2-pack, or 10-inch box. A loose fit can cause the box to shift, increasing the risk of damage. For display purposes, UV-resistant options are ideal as they help prevent fading over time. If you're building a collection, buying in bulk can save money.
How to Put On Soft Protectors Correctly
Start by peeling off the protective film to ensure clear visibility. Open the protector from the top and gently fold the corners to help it maintain its shape. Before inserting your Funko POP! box, dust it with a microfiber cloth or a makeup brush to avoid micro-scratches. Then, carefully slide the box into the protector. If it feels too tight, stop - forcing it could result in creases or crushed corners. Once the box is in, close the top flap so it seals securely at the back. Always handle both the protector and box with clean, dry hands to avoid transferring oils or dirt.

Hard Cases for Heavy-Duty Protection
Soft Protectors vs Hard Cases: Funko POP Storage Comparison
Hard cases, often referred to as "Hard-Stacks", take protection to the next level compared to soft protectors. Made from thick acrylic, usually between 3.0mm and 4.0mm, these cases offer a rigid shield that soft options simply can't match. They prevent common issues like warping, crushing, and dents from accidental drops. Plus, they’re strong enough to support stacking up to 10 figures high without damaging the lower boxes, combining durability with practicality. Another bonus? The acrylic material blocks UV rays, protecting the artwork from fading and keeping the plastic windows from yellowing over time.
Of course, this level of protection comes at a price. Hard cases typically cost about 10 times more than soft protectors. For standard 4-inch figures, prices generally range from $34.99 to $39.99. Specialty sizes, such as those for 6-inch or 2-pack figures, can go up to $54.99.
When to Use Hard Cases
Hard cases are best saved for your "Grails" - those rare, pricey, or deeply sentimental figures where preserving the box in mint condition is non-negotiable. For instance, a high-value collectible like the Alex DeLarge Clockwork Orange Funko Pop, which is valued at $13,400, absolutely warrants this level of protection.
They're also a smart choice if you frequently move your collection or ship figures, as they safeguard against crushing during transit. And if you’re displaying your collection in a room exposed to natural light, the UV-blocking properties of hard cases are a must, even if you’re careful to avoid direct sunlight.
What to Look for in a Hard Case
When choosing a hard case, focus on these key features:
- Material thickness: Opt for acrylic between 3.0mm and 4.0mm to ensure sturdy protection.
- UV protection: This is critical for preventing fading and yellowing of both the artwork and the plastic bubble.
- Closure system: Decide between magnetic bottoms for easy access or slide-bottom designs for a tighter seal.
- Precision sizing: Measure your figure’s bubble depth, especially for oversized or 6-inch Pops, to avoid rattling or pressure on the window.
- Stackability: If you plan to stack multiple figures, ensure the case can handle vertical weight without compromising stability.

Climate Control: Protecting Against Humidity, Heat, and Sunlight
Even with the sturdiest protectors and cases, your Funko POP! boxes can still fall victim to damage if stored in less-than-ideal conditions. Fluctuating temperatures, moisture, and light exposure can permanently harm both the cardboard packaging and vinyl figures inside. Let’s break down the best ways to safeguard your collectibles by managing temperature, humidity, and light.
Best Temperature and Humidity Levels
To keep your collection in top shape, aim for a stable temperature between 68°F and 72°F. While a range of 64°F to 77°F is generally safe, consistency is key. Humidity levels should stay between 40% and 50% for the best results.
Why does this matter? High heat can weaken adhesives and cause cardboard to warp, while frequent temperature changes make vinyl expand and contract, potentially leading to cracks. Too much moisture encourages mold and can leave vinyl feeling sticky, while overly dry conditions can make cardboard brittle.
Equipment for Climate Control
Keeping your collection safe from environmental damage doesn’t have to be complicated. Here are some tools that can help:
- Digital Hygrometer: This handy device monitors temperature and humidity in real time, giving you the data you need to act quickly.
- Dehumidifier: Perfect for damp spaces, it removes excess moisture from the air.
- Silica Gel Packets: Adding these to storage bins or display cases provides extra moisture protection.
- Humidifier: In dry climates, this prevents cardboard from drying out and cracking.
- LED Lighting: Choose LED bulbs (warm or cool white) for displays. They emit minimal UV radiation and produce very little heat, making them safe for your collection.
- Motion-Sensor Switches or Timers: These limit light exposure, further protecting your collectibles.
How to Prevent Sunlight Damage
Sunlight is one of the biggest threats to your Funko POP! figures. UV rays can fade colors, yellow white vinyl, and even make plastic joints brittle over time.
"Vinyl is highly susceptible to photodegradation. Even low-level, consistent UV exposure accelerates oxidation, leading to both cosmetic and structural deterioration. Prevention is far more effective than restoration." – Dr. Lena Torres, Materials Conservation Specialist at the National Collectibles Preservation Institute
To combat UV damage, consider these steps:
- UV-Blocking Window Film: This can block up to 99% of harmful UV rays.
- Blackout Curtains: These are ideal for rooms where sunlight is unavoidable.
- Avoid South-Facing Displays: Keep your collection away from direct sunlight or skylights.
- Monitor Light Levels: Use a smartphone app to ensure light levels stay below 50 lux.
- Rotate Displays: By rotating figures between display and storage every few months, you can reduce the overall light exposure.

How to Organize and Store Funko POP! Boxes
Once you've taken steps to protect your collection from potential damage, the next priority is figuring out how to organize and store your Funko POP! boxes. Proper storage can mean the difference between maintaining a pristine collection and one that loses its value due to damage like crushing, bending, or creasing.
Choosing the Best Storage Containers
The right container can make all the difference. Plastic tubs or bins are a great option - they’re sturdy, waterproof, and resistant to pests. When choosing these, go for ones with straight vertical walls rather than slanted sides. Straight walls allow for neat, stable stacking, while slanted walls can cause boxes to shift or tilt. If slanted bins are your only option, fill the gaps with bubble wrap to keep everything secure.
Another budget-friendly option is bankers boxes. These cardboard boxes are sized well for Funko POP! dimensions and are easy to stack. They’re also affordable, especially in bulk. However, they’re not ideal for areas prone to moisture or flooding, so they’re better suited for climate-controlled spaces. For collectors with high-value figures, hard-stack cases provide excellent protection, though they come at a higher price point.
Regardless of the container type, always use acid-free protectors for individual boxes to safeguard against chemical damage. And whatever you do, avoid placing containers directly on the floor. Elevate them on shelves, desks, or pallets to protect against water damage and pests.
Stacking Boxes the Right Way
Proper stacking is just as important as choosing the right container. Always store Funko POP! boxes in an upright, vertical position. This allows the weight to rest on the corners, which are the strongest parts of the box, reducing the risk of crushing. For added protection, place dividers or cushioning materials like bubble wrap or foam sheets between layers to prevent shifting or friction.
Sorting by Series or Theme
Once your boxes are physically protected, it’s time to organize them in a way that makes your collection easy to browse. Sorting by series, theme, or rarity not only improves presentation but also makes it simple to find specific figures without unnecessary handling.
For example, you can group boxes by franchises like Marvel, Star Wars, or Disney, or by release date or character type. To keep everything organized, label your storage containers with a number or code using a label maker or marker. Then, maintain a digital inventory - a spreadsheet in Excel or Google Sheets works well - to track which figures are in which container. This system saves time and minimizes the risk of damaging boxes while searching.
If you’re managing a large collection, try a tiered storage system:
- Showcase Tier: Display your most prized pieces in UV-filtered cases to protect them from light damage.
- Rotation Tier: Use this for seasonal favorites that you want to display temporarily.
- Storage Tier: Keep high-value or less frequently displayed items in archival-safe containers.

FAQs
Do I need protectors if I don’t display my Pops?
Protectors aren’t a must-have if your Funko Pops stay tucked away and out of sight. However, they can be a great way to keep the boxes in good shape while in storage. To safeguard their condition, focus on proper storage techniques - keep them away from dust, humidity, and direct sunlight to avoid damage and maintain their value.
What’s the best way to store Pops in a closet or basement?
To store your Funko POPs safely in a closet or basement, make sure to place them on an elevated, dry surface. This helps protect them from moisture and potential pests. Choose a clean, dark, and climate-controlled space to shield them from dust, sunlight, and temperature fluctuations. For long-term storage, using clear plastic protectors or acid-free materials can add an extra layer of protection. Avoid setting boxes directly on the floor or in areas with high humidity, such as unfinished basements or attics.
How do I prevent box corners from getting crushed in storage?
To keep your Funko POP! box corners in great condition, consider using protective cases like acrylic hard shells or archival-grade sleeves. These help preserve the box's shape and shield it from wear. When storing, opt for stable, flat containers that are just slightly larger than the boxes to evenly spread out weight. Avoid stacking too many boxes or placing heavy objects on top, as this can cause crushing or warping. Lastly, store them in a cool, dry spot to protect against humidity and pressure-related damage.
